Bug 20603

Summary: Kmail is unstable when the 'nouveau' nvidia driver is in use (not if proprietary driver 340 is in use)
Product: Mageia Reporter: Maurice Batey <maurice77>
Component: RPM PackagesAssignee: KDE maintainers <kde>
Status: RESOLVED FIXED QA Contact:
Severity: normal    
Priority: Normal CC: mageia, marja11
Version: CauldronKeywords: 6RC
Target Milestone: ---   
Hardware: x86_64   
OS: Linux   
Whiteboard:
Source RPM: kmail-16.12.3-1.mga6.src.rpm CVE:
Status comment:

Description Maurice Batey 2017-03-30 18:03:37 CEST
Description of problem:


Version-Release number of selected component (if applicable):

5.4.3

How reproducible:


Steps to Reproduce:

1. Start Kmail when 'nouveau' nvidia driver is in use.

2. After 2 or 3 mouse selections anywhere kmail crashes/disappears.

3. (This happened with Mageia-6-sta2 and now with Mageia-6-rc, and has been reported elsewhere)
Maurice Batey 2017-03-30 18:05:52 CEST

Keywords: (none) => 6RC

Comment 1 PC LX 2017-03-30 19:18:57 CEST
This issue may be a duplicate of issue 19982. Please read 19982 description and see if it is so.

CC: (none) => mageia

Comment 2 Maurice Batey 2017-03-30 19:48:29 CEST
Well, not exactly (never use Akregator), but I see others in here have reported Kmail crashing under 'nouveau'.

This bug report is solely about Kmail & nouveau. 
  I leave it to the management to decide whether or not this one should be regarded as a duplicate of 19982...
Comment 3 PC LX 2017-03-30 20:08:56 CEST
This issue report lacks details (e.g. error messages) so it is not easy to see if it is the same issue as 19982 or not.

If you could post the output of kmail when it crashes, so that a comparison could be made, would help a lot.
Comment 4 Maurice Batey 2017-03-30 20:24:00 CEST
I don't remember seeing any error messages when it crashed.
   'strace' might throw up too much, so will look for system option offering crash info.
Marja Van Waes 2017-03-30 20:36:13 CEST

CC: (none) => marja11
Assignee: bugsquad => kde

Comment 5 PC LX 2017-03-30 20:37:56 CEST
When running kmail from a console/terminal (e.g. konsole), does it show any error messages?
Comment 6 Maurice Batey 2017-03-31 11:51:44 CEST
Just tried from terminal. 
Well, it didn't crash out as has been doing, but after several mouse clicks to select various options it did FREEZE!

This is what then appeared in the terminal session, after the error window appeared ("The application is not responding, etc....):

---------------------------------------------------
$ kmail
Pass a valid window to KWallet::Wallet::openWallet().
The kwalletd service has been registered
this does not work on a KActionCollection containing actions!
QDBusConnection: name 'org.kde.kwalletd5' had owner '' but we thought it was 
':1.69'
org.kde.akonadi.ETM: GEN true false false
org.kde.akonadi.ETM: collection: QVector()
org.kde.akonadi.ETM: 
org.kde.akonadi.ETM: Subtree:  17 QSet(67, 17, 68, 69, 70, 71, 72)
org.kde.akonadi.ETM: Subtree:  1 QSet(1, 61)
org.kde.akonadi.ETM: Fetch job took  294 msec
org.kde.akonadi.ETM: was collection fetch job: collections: 9
org.kde.akonadi.ETM: first fetched collection: "Search"
org.kde.akonadi.ETM: Fetch job took  364 msec
org.kde.akonadi.ETM: was collection fetch job: collections: 9
org.kde.akonadi.ETM: first fetched collection: "Search"
Error loading plugin: "The shared library was not found."
Error loading plugin: "The shared library was not found."
Error loading plugin: "The shared library was not found."
Error loading plugin: "The shared library was not found."
Hspell: can't open /usr/share/hspell/hebrew.wgz.sizes.
sonnet.plugins.hspell: HSpellDict::HSpellDict: Init failed
sonnet.core: Unhandled script 126
sonnet.core: Unhandled script 127
sonnet.core: Unhandled script 128
sonnet.core: Unhandled script 129
sonnet.core: Unhandled script 130
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.ui: No dictionary for " "en-GB" " staying with the current language.
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: deleting 0x346bd70 for "en-GB"
sonnet.core: deleting 0x3470be8 for "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.ui: No dictionary for " "en-GB" " staying with the current language.
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: deleting 0x34a2840 for "en-GB"
sonnet.core: deleting 0x34a6318 for "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.ui: No dictionary for " "en-GB" " staying with the current language.
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: deleting 0x34db220 for "en-GB"
sonnet.core: deleting 0x34decf8 for "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.ui: No dictionary for " "en-GB" " staying with the current language.
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: deleting 0x351bb10 for "en-GB"
sonnet.core: deleting 0x351f5e8 for "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.ui: No dictionary for " "en-GB" " staying with the current language.
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: deleting 0x35be740 for "en-GB"
sonnet.core: deleting 0x35bf008 for "en-GB"
Error loading plugin: "The shared library was not found."
Error loading plugin: "The shared library was not found."
Error loading plugin: "The shared library was not found."
ATTENTION: default value of option force_s3tc_enable overridden by environment.
org.kde.akonadi.ETM: GEN true false true
org.kde.akonadi.ETM: collection: QVector()
org.kde.akonadi.ETM: Subtree:  2 QSet(2)
org.kde.akonadi.ETM: collection: "Personal Contacts"
org.kde.akonadi.ETM: Fetch job took  308 msec
org.kde.akonadi.ETM: was collection fetch job: collections: 1
org.kde.akonadi.ETM: first fetched collection: "Personal Contacts"
org.kde.akonadi.ETM: Fetch job took  106 msec
org.kde.akonadi.ETM: was item fetch job: items: 202
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: deleting 0x3380760 for "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: No language dictionaries for the language: "en-GB"
sonnet.core: deleting 0x3aa92f0 for "en-GB"
sonnet.core: deleting 0x3aa8f48 for "en-GB"
sonnet.ui: name not found "English (United Kingdom)"
sonnet.core: deleting 0x3aa8d90 for "en-GB"
sonnet.core: deleting 0x3abc108 for "en-GB"
org.kde.akonadi.ETM: collection: "inbox"
org.kde.akonadi.ETM: Fetch job took  94 msec
org.kde.akonadi.ETM: was item fetch job: items: 4
Killed
$
------------------------------------

N.B. I'm soon going to be trying to return to the proprietary nvidia driver (340), so may not be able to repeat the 'nouveau' check!
Comment 7 Maurice Batey 2019-02-21 18:40:40 CET
No such recurrence for almost 2 years so time to Close...

Resolution: (none) => FIXED
Status: NEW => RESOLVED